Kuwait Building Fire Claims Over 35 Lives, Leaves Dozens Injured

The Kuwaiti interior ministry reported that more than 35 individuals lost their lives and dozens sustained injuries in a tragic building fire in an area densely populated with foreign workers on Wednesday.
According to the health ministry, forty-three people were wounded when the fire erupted in a residential building located south of Kuwait City early in the morning.
Major General Eid Al-Owaihan, director of the interior ministry’s General Department of Criminal Evidence, confirmed the incident during a site visit, stating, “Unfortunately, we received a report of a fire at… exactly 6:00 am (0300 GMT) in the Mangaf area. As for the deaths in the building behind me, the number has exceeded 35 so far.”
Owaihan further mentioned that forensic teams had identified three of the deceased individuals.
A source from the General Fire Department revealed that the victims suffocated due to the smoke rising from the fire, which originated on the ground floor of the building.
Interior Minister Sheikh Fahd Al-Yousef, while visiting the scene, announced that the building’s owner had been detained as part of an investigation into potential negligence.
